I need help getting Sane/XSane (scanner) working on Debian.
This is a fresh install of Debian Jessie. I previously had no trouble with scanning via Ubuntu on the exact same computer/scanner/printer setup. Printing is fine on both OS's. It's just scanning that won't work on Debian.
When I attempt scanning, I can hear the scanner moving, but then an error occurs before the image shows up. Here are the errors:
-using XSane: "Error during read: Error during device I/O."
-using Simple Scan: "Failed to scan Error communicating with scanner"
----
I also tried using Sane directly from command line, and this is what I get:
#root@debianos:/home/me# sane-find-scanner
found USB scanner (vendor=0x040a [Eastman Kodak Company], product=0x4066 [KODAK ESP Office 2170 Series]) at libusb:001:008
#root@debianos:/home/me# scanimage -L
device `v4l:/dev/video0' is a Noname HD WebCam virtual device
device `kodakaio:libusb:001:008' is a Kodak KODAK ESP Office 2170 Series flatbed scanner
#root@debianos:/home/me# scanimage -d kodakaio --format pnm > [login to view URL]
scanimage: sane_read: Error during device I/O
----
Other things I have tried:
-running XSane/SimpleScan as user or "root" does not make any difference (same error).
-commented out all irrelevant devices in /etc/sane.d/[login to view URL]
-confirmed that /lib/udev/rules.d/[login to view URL] listed my scanner's correct vendor/product ID (it did).
----
Again, I have no trouble scanning using Ubuntu on the same computer/scanner combo, so I'm thinking this should be possible on Debian.
